Engine Type:
4-stroke, SOHC, V-twin
Bore X Stroke:
83.0 x 73.0 mm
Cooling System:
Liquid-cooled
Horsepower:
Approx. 50 HP @ 6,000 RPM (factory spec may vary slightly)
Torque:
Approx. 64 Nm (47 lb-ft) @ 4,000 RPM (factory spec may vary slightly)
Carburetor:
Dual Keihin CVK34
Fuel Tank Capacity:
14 Liters (3.7 US gal)
Ignition System:
Digital CDI

Oil Change Interval:
Refer to manual; typically every 6,000 km (3,700 miles) or 6 months.
Filter Change Interval:
Refer to manual; usually coincides with oil changes.
Chain Maintenance:
Lubrication and adjustment every 1,000 km (600 miles) or after washing/rain riding.
Spark Plug Replacement:
Refer to manual; typically around 12,000 km (7,500 miles).
Engine Oil Viscosity:
SAE 10W-40 (or as specified in the manual).
Brake Fluid Type:
DOT 4 (or as specified in the manual).
Coolant Type:
Ethylene glycol based coolant with demineralized water (50:50 mix) (or as specified).
Carburetor Issues:
Can be prone to fuel gumming if left stored for extended periods without draining fuel. Synchronization might be needed over time.
Rear Brake Wear:
Drum brake on rear can wear and require adjustment or replacement of shoes.
Electrical Connections:
As with many motorcycles of this age, corrosion on electrical connectors can sometimes cause intermittent issues.

Vn800 Lineage:
The VN800 platform was introduced in the mid-1990s and evolved through various iterations including the Classic and Drifter models. The VN800-B5 is part of this established cruiser line.
Production Period:
The VN800 series was produced for approximately a decade, with the VN800-B5 representing a specific model year within that range.
